The Importance Of Using Medical Inventory Management Software

In the fast-paced and ever-evolving world of healthcare, it is crucial for medical facilities to efficiently manage their inventory of supplies and medications. Proper inventory management not only helps to ensure that patients receive the care they need in a timely manner, but it also contributes to the overall efficiency and profitability of the facility. This is where medical inventory management software comes into play.

medical inventory management software is a powerful tool that helps healthcare providers keep track of their inventory levels, streamline their ordering processes, and reduce waste and inefficiencies. This software can be used in a variety of healthcare settings, from hospitals and clinics to pharmacies and laboratories. By leveraging the capabilities of medical inventory management software, healthcare facilities can improve patient care, increase revenue, and enhance overall operations.

One of the primary benefits of using medical inventory management software is improved accuracy and efficiency. Manual inventory management processes are time-consuming and prone to errors, which can result in stockouts, overstocking, and expired medications. medical inventory management software automates many of these processes, helping healthcare providers to better track their inventory levels, expiration dates, and usage rates. This level of accuracy not only ensures that patients receive the medications and supplies they need when they need them, but it also helps healthcare facilities to reduce waste and save money.

Another key benefit of medical inventory management software is improved visibility and control over inventory levels. With real-time tracking and reporting capabilities, healthcare providers can quickly assess their inventory levels and make informed decisions about ordering and restocking. This level of visibility helps to prevent stockouts and overstocking, which can negatively impact patient care and the facility’s bottom line. By accurately predicting demand and optimizing inventory levels, healthcare facilities can reduce costs, improve operational efficiency, and enhance the overall patient experience.

In addition to improving accuracy and visibility, medical inventory management software also offers advanced features such as barcode scanning, batch tracking, and expiration date tracking. These features help healthcare providers to easily identify and locate specific items within their inventory, streamline the receiving and restocking process, and ensure that medications and supplies are used before they expire. By leveraging these advanced features, healthcare facilities can improve patient safety, optimize inventory turnover, and comply with regulatory requirements.

Furthermore, medical inventory management software is designed to integrate seamlessly with other healthcare systems, such as electronic medical records (EMR) and billing systems. By connecting these systems, healthcare providers can streamline their workflows, reduce manual data entry errors, and improve overall data accuracy. This integration not only saves time and resources, but it also helps healthcare facilities to better track patient outcomes, manage costs, and comply with regulatory standards.
